About Ravyn Lenae
Ravyn Lenae Washington, known professionally as Ravyn Lenae, has swiftly ascended as a pivotal figure in the modern R&B landscape. Hailing from Chicago, her musical journey began early, culminating in a signing with Atlantic Records and the release of her debut EP, Moon Shoes, in 2015. Lenae’s sound is a delicate tapestry woven with neo-soul influences, experimental R&B textures, and a vocal delivery that is both delicate and incredibly powerful. Her early EPs, including Midnight Moonlight and the critically lauded Crush, produced by Steve Lacy, established her as an artist unafraid to explore complex emotions and sonic landscapes.
Her debut album, Hypnos, released in 2022, solidified her status as a visionary. Featuring collaborations with the likes of Smino and Fousheé, Hypnos showcased her growth as a songwriter and vocalist, delving into themes of self-discovery, love, and spiritual awakening. Tracks like “Skin Tight” and “Light Me Up” exemplify her ability to craft lush, atmospheric grooves that are both introspective and utterly captivating. Live, Ravyn Lenae is renowned for her commanding yet intimate performances, often accompanied by a tight band that enhances the intricate layers of her studio recordings, delivering a truly immersive and unforgettable experience.
Roundhouse: The Perfect Setting
Nestled in the heart of Camden Town, the Roundhouse stands as one of London’s most revered and distinctive music venues. Originally built in 1847 as a railway engine shed, its rich history as a cultural epicentre dates back to the 1960s, hosting legendary acts from The Rolling Stones to Pink Floyd. Today, it continues its legacy as a dynamic arts venue, capable of accommodating around 1,700 to 3,300 standing patrons, depending on the event configuration, providing an intimate yet grand setting for performances.
The venue’s unique circular structure and industrial-chic aesthetic create an unparalleled atmosphere, where every note resonates with a palpable energy. Its high ceilings and robust architecture lend themselves to incredible acoustics, ensuring Ravyn Lenae’s nuanced vocals and intricate arrangements will be heard with pristine clarity. Beyond its striking appearance, the Roundhouse is committed to accessibility, offering step-free access, accessible toilets, and dedicated viewing platforms for those with specific needs, ensuring a comfortable experience for all attendees. Its location in vibrant Camden also means it’s surrounded by an array of pre-show dining and post-show entertainment options.

Getting to Roundhouse
The Roundhouse is conveniently located in London’s Camden Town, making it highly accessible via public transport. The closest London Underground stations are Chalk Farm (Northern Line), which is just a two-minute walk away, and Camden Town (Northern Line), approximately a ten-minute walk. Both stations offer direct links to central London and beyond, making travel straightforward for most attendees.
Numerous bus routes also serve the area, with stops directly outside or very close to the venue. Key routes include the 24, 27, 31, 168, and 393, providing excellent connections from various parts of the city. While driving is an option, parking in Camden is extremely limited and can be expensive, so public transport is highly recommended. The venue’s postcode is NW1 8EH, which can be used for navigation apps or taxi services. Planning your journey in advance is always advisable, especially for a Monday evening event.
